Transaction 645654fd2c6aba27c51f3db24bd04af384c199af9cd943605ad46c763d457a6a
1 Input
1 Output
-
645654fd2c6aba27c51f3db24bd04af384c199af9cd943605ad46c763d457a6a:0
- value
- 591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4340d0f92e4c582b36346ee8087a63f227bcee30 OP_EQUAL
- address
- 37pcqurHpL1pn7XW5TYhP1EvYYasLevhtY